typedef struct DIRECTMANIPULATION_AUTOSCROLL_CONFIGURATION {
UINT32 tickCount;
FLOAT endMultiplier;
FLOAT tickMultiplier;
} DIRECTMANIPULATION_AUTOSCROLL_CONFIGURATION;
这个结构体包含了以下字段:
- tickCount: 表示触发自动滚动的时间间隔(以毫秒为单位)。
- endMultiplier: 表示在滚动停止时的滚动速度的倍率。
- tickMultiplier: 表示在每个时间间隔内的滚动速度的倍率。
这些配置参数用于定义 DirectManipulation 操作中的自动滚动行为。在使用 DirectManipulation 进行滚动时,可以通过配置这些参数来调整自动滚动的速度和行为。
请注意,使用 DirectManipulation API 需要在代码中链接到 dwmapi.lib 库,并且支持的系统版本可能有所不同。确保在使用这些功能时查阅最新的 Microsoft 文档以获取详细信息。
转载请注明出处:http://www.zyzy.cn/article/detail/26806/Win32 API/Directmanipulation.h/DIRECTMANIPULATION_AUTOSCROLL_CONFIGURATION